Hannah Clark

(18 July 1830 - 17 February 1908)
     Hannah Clark was christened on 18 July 1830 in Parish Church, Over Silton, Yorkshire. She was the daughter of James Clark and Jane Fairweather. Hannah was recorded in the census of 6 June 1841 living in Over Silton, Yorkshire. She was enumerated as Hannah Clark, age 11, born in Yorkshire. As of 28 June 1856 her married name was Turner. She married Henry Turner, son of Richard Turner and Elizabeth Prince, on 28 June 1856 in Parish Church, Topcliffe, Yorkshire. Hannah was recorded in the census of 7 April 1861 living in Dishforth, Yorkshire. She was enumerated as Hannah Turner, wife of Henry Turner, married, age 29, farmer's wife, born in Over Silton, Yorkshire. Hannah was recorded in the census of 2 April 1871 living in Main Street, Dishforth, Yorkshire. She was enumerated as Hannah Turner, wife of Henry Turner, married, age 40, farmer's wife, born in Over Silton, Yorkshire. She was the official informant of the death of Henry Turner on 10 October 1876 in Dishforth. Hannah was recorded in the census of 3 April 1881 living in Village Street, Dishforth, Yorkshire. She was enumerated as Hannah Turner, head of household, widow, age 49, retired farmer, born in Over Silton, Yorkshire. Hannah was recorded in the census of 31 March 1901 living in 2 Dickinson Street, Darlington, Co Durham. She was enumerated as Hannah Turner, head of household, widow, age 70, grocer c shopkeeper, own account, born in Over Silton, Yorkshire. She left a will on 11 February 1906 in 3 Saint Johns Place, Darlington, Co Durham. She died on 17 February 1908 in Grey Horse Hotel, St Johns Place, Darlington, Co Durham, at age 77. Hannah died of senile decay and heart failure.

James Clark

(16 September 1804 - 24 April 1866)
     James Clark was a stone cutter / mason. He was born on 16 September 1804 in Durham City. He was the son of Thomas Clark and Mary Cockerill. James Clark was christened on 25 December 1804 in St. Giles, Durham City. He married Jane Fairweather, daughter of John Fairweather and Ann Willson, on 28 November 1825 in Parish Church, Over Silton, Yorkshire. James was recorded in the census of 6 June 1841 living in Over Silton, Yorkshire. He was enumerated as James Clark, age 35, labourer, born in Yorkshire. James was recorded in the census of 30 March 1851 living in Over Silton. He was enumerated as James Clark, head of household, married, age 46, stone cutter, born in Durham City. James was recorded in the census of 7 April 1861 living in Over Silton. He was enumerated as James Clark, head of household, married, age 56, stone cutter, occupier 8 acres, born in Durham. He died on 24 April 1866 in Over Silton at age 61. James died of phthisis.

Jane Elizabeth Clark

(before 3 April 1850 - )
     Jane Elizabeth Clark was born before 3 April 1850 in Ohio, U.S.A. She was the daughter of Thomas Clark. Jane Elizabeth Clark lived in Linthorpe Road, Middlesbrough, Yorkshire, on 20 June 1870. She married Horatio John Tweddell, son of George Markham Tweddell and Elizabeth Cole, on 20 June 1870 in St John's Parish Church, Middlesbrough, Yorkshire. As of 20 June 1870 her married name was Tweddell. Jane was recorded in the census of 2 April 1871 living in High Street, Stokesley, Yorkshire. She was enumerated as Jane E Tweddell, wife of Horatio J Tweddell, married, age 21, born in Ohio, America, British Subject. Jane was recorded in the census of 3 April 1881 living in Commercial Row, Stokesley, Yorkshire. She was enumerated as Jane E Tweddell, wife of Horatio J Tweddell, married, age 31, born in America, British subject. Jane was recorded in the census of 5 April 1891 living in 12 Cunliffe Street, Mold, Flintshire, Wales. She was enumerated as Jane E Tweddle, head of household, married, age 41, dressmaker, employer, born in Ohio, America, speaks English. Jane was recorded in the census of 31 March 1901 living in 12 Cunliffe Street, Mold. She was enumerated as Jane E Tweddell, wife of Horatio J Tweddell, married, age 51, dressmaker, own account, working at home, born in United States, British subject, English spoken.
